Job Description Weekend Shift 5:00am-5:30pm (Friday, Saturday, Sunday) Job Description This role focuses on assembling and testing insulin pumps in a cleanroom production environment on a weekend shift schedule. You work at designated pump stations on a manufacturing line, performing electromechanical assembly, testing, troubleshooting, and data entry to meet daily output and quality metrics. You follow detailed work instructions and standard operating procedures, maintain accurate documentation, and help ensure a clean, safe, and efficient workspace. Responsibilities • Work in the pump department assembling insulin pumps on a manufacturing line with designated workstations., • Perform manual electromechanical assembly duties using small hand tools and other equipment as required., • Operate within a cleanroom production environment, following all applicable standard operating procedures (SOPs)., • Use a computer regularly to enter and log data, complete training modules, and manage documentation., • Receive, test, and inspect new and returned pumps according to established procedures and quality standards., • Become certified on three different pump stations and rotate across stations as needed., • Perform testing and basic troubleshooting on pumps and related components to ensure proper function., • Review batch records and monitor documentation for accuracy, completeness, and compliance with GMP and medical device requirements., • Follow work instructions carefully and maintain high attention to detail while working at a fast pace., • Support packaging and inspection activities related to medical device production as needed., • Collaborate with team members on the line to complete assemblies and meet daily output and performance metrics., • Maintain a clean, organized, and safe work environment, promptly addressing any safety or quality concerns., • Demonstrate consistent attendance and reliability by showing up on time for all scheduled weekend shifts., • Be flexible and willing to be cross-trained in different departments and stations, taking on any task required to support production goals. Work Environment This position is based in a cleanroom production setting within a pump department, working on a manufacturing line with clearly defined workstations. You work closely with a team and must be comfortable in a loud environment with ongoing machinery noise. The role requires extensive use of computers for training and documentation, as well as regular use of small hand tools for assembly and testing. The schedule is a weekend shift, Friday through Sunday, with 12-hour shifts from approximately 5:00 a.m. to 5:30 p.m. The environment emphasizes safety, cleanliness, and adherence to SOPs and GMP standards while maintaining a fast-paced, team-oriented atmosphere.
